@charset "utf-8";
/* CSS Document */

 .box-langgan {width:70%; margin-left:auto; margin-right:auto; margin-bottom:35px; 
min-height:220px; padding:15px 25px; background-color:#BADFF5;webkit-box-shadow: 0px 0px 10px -1px rgba(97,97,97,1);
-moz-box-shadow: 0px 0px 10px -1px rgba(97,97,97,1);
box-shadow: 0px 0px 10px -1px rgba(97,97,97,1);}
.txt-jd_lgg { font-size:36px; font-weight:bold;}
.txt_lgg { font-size:22px;}.txt-btn-lgg { font-size:18px;}
@media only screen and (max-width:460px){
.box-langgan { width:80%; min-height:150px}
.txt-jd_lgg { font-size:30px;}
.txt_lgg  {font-size:18px;}.txt-btn-lgg { font-size:15px;}
}


.col-cus{width:30%;float:left}.col-dev{width:5%;float:left}.col-sl{width:16.25%;float:left}@media only screen and (min-width:801px) and (max-width:1099px){.col-cus{width:calc(20% - 10px);margin-left:10px}.col-dev{width:3%;float:left}.col-sl{width:19.25%;float:left}}@media only screen and (max-width:800px){.col-cus,.col-sl{width:calc(100% - 20px);margin-left:10px;margin-right:10px;margin-bottom:15px}.col-dev{display:none}}

.pengumuman-insight {width:100%;min-height:20px; padding:15px 0; background-color:#efefef;}
.btn-langgan {padding:7px 15px; background-color:#F00; color:#FFF; text-align:center; border-radius:5px; margin-left:10px;}

@media only screen and (max-width:1100px){
	
	.pengumuman-insight {width:100%;min-height:70px; padding:15px 0; background-color:#efefef;}
	.posmobilelgg { margin-top:40px !important; line-height:35px;}
	
}
	